Rumours around Apple’s first foldable iPhone have been circulating for a while. But now a clearer launch timeline is starting to emerge. According to Mark Gurman from Bloomberg, the much-anticipated iPhone Fold will arrive later than the iPhone 18 Pro and iPhone 18 Pro Max models expected in September. Here’s more on that.
During a live Q&A session, Gurman addressed questions regarding the release timeline of Apple’s foldable device. He stated that there is “no doubt” the iPhone Fold will launch shortly after the September rollout of the iPhone 18 Pro and Pro Max models.
Earlier speculation suggested that the foldable iPhone could be introduced soon after the September event. However, a recent report from a Barclays analyst hinted that the device might not arrive until December. This would be roughly three months after the iPhone 18 Pro lineup hits the market.
Gurman attributes this delay to the complex manufacturing process involved in creating foldable displays. He explained that such advanced display technology is among the most difficult to produce at scale.
He said, “Foldable phones are very difficult to produce. That display technology is some of the most complex display technology available on the market today. And so there is no doubt that this is going to come a little bit later than the Pro phones. […] Whenever Apple does a major new form factor design, something specifically that’s pretty complex as we saw with the iPhone X back a decade ago, you’re going to be a little bit delayed past the other models.”
Apple has previously delayed products featuring new and complex designs. iPhone X was unveiled alongside the iPhone 8 and iPhone 8 Plus in September 2017, but was released later in November 2017. The delay was reportedly due to challenges in producing its OLED display and TrueDepth camera system with Face ID.
The iPhone Fold is expected to carry a starting price of over $2,000, which would make it the most expensive iPhone to date. Gurman also revealed that the device is among the Apple products he has been most excited about in the past four to five years.
Reports suggest that the foldable iPhone could feature a creaseless internal display, which is likely to be a major highlight. Apple is expected to optimise this large inner screen for video consumption and gaming experiences.
Gurman expressed enthusiasm for the upcoming device, saying he is “super pumped” about the foldable iPhone. He believes the product will perform well in the market and could also boost the success of the iPhone 18 Pro lineup.
